Process Oil — Rubber & Polymer Extender Oil

Process oils extend and plasticise rubber and polymer compounds, lowering viscosity and improving filler incorporation. Allzone supplies process oil grades to Canadian compounders and adhesive manufacturers with the grade confirmed against supplier documentation.

Technical & procurement detail

Functional role of process oil+

In a compound, process oil softens the polymer matrix so mixing energy drops, filler disperses evenly and the finished part reaches its target hardness at lower cost. In hot-melt and TPE systems the same oil controls melt viscosity and open time.

Selecting the right grade+

Oil type — paraffinic, naphthenic or white oil — determines compatibility, colour and low-temperature behaviour, and viscosity, aniline point and volatility follow. Polymer type, colour requirement, service temperature and any regulatory constraint determine what is quoted.

Which oil type suits my polymer?+

Compatibility follows the polymer's polarity and the colour and regulatory requirements of the part. Share the polymer, target hardness and any colour or contact requirement and the correct oil type is confirmed with the supplier.
